Concrete overlaying services involve applying a new layer of concrete material over existing concrete surfaces to improve their appearance and durability. This process typically includes cleaning and preparing the existing surface, followed by the application of a specially formulated overlay that can mimic the look of stone, brick, or other decorative finishes. The goal is to refresh worn or damaged concrete, creating a smooth, attractive surface that can last for years with proper care. This service offers an efficient way to upgrade driveways, patios, walkways, or garage floors without the need for complete replacement.

One of the primary problems concrete overlaying helps solve is surface deterioration. Over time, concrete can develop cracks, stains, or uneven areas due to weather exposure, heavy use, or shifting ground. Instead of costly removal and replacement, overlaying provides a cost-effective solution to conceal imperfections, reinforce the surface, and extend its lifespan. It can also address issues like surface spalling, surface stains, or surface scaling, restoring both the look and functionality of the concrete. This makes it an appealing choice for property owners seeking to improve curb appeal and safety without extensive demolition work.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Overlaying proj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Post Falls, ID.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or concrete overlay projects in Post Falls range from $250-$600. Many routine resurfacing jobs fall within this range, depending on the size and condition of the existing surface.

Mid-Size Projects - Larger, more detailed overlay work usually costs between $600-$2,000. These projects often involve more surface area or additional design elements, with many falling into this middle tier.

Large or Complex Overlays - Extensive overlays or custom finishes can range from $2,000-$5,000 or more. Fewer projects reach this high end, typically involving intricate patterns or significant surface preparation.

Full Surface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of existing concrete can exceed $5,000, depending on the scope and site conditions. Most local contractors handle overlay projects rather than full replacements, which are less common for typical jobs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is concrete overlaying? Concrete overlaying involves applying a thin layer of specialized concrete over existing surfaces to improve appearance and durability.

Can concrete overlays be used on different surfaces? Yes, concrete overlays can be applied to various surfaces such as driveways, patios, and walkways to enhance their look and longevity.

Are concrete overlays suitable for outdoor use? Absolutely, concrete overlays are commonly used outdoors to withstand weather conditions and provide a durable finish.

How long do concrete overlays typically last? The lifespan of a concrete overlay depends on factors like installation quality and maintenance, but they are designed for long-term use.

What benefits do concrete overlays offer compared to replacing existing surfaces? Concrete overlays can improve the appearance, add durability, and often cost less than complete surface replacements.
